EnviroSustain is excited to announce a new ten-year partnership with Rewilding Europe. Rewilding Europe is an independent, non-for-profit foundation that supports rewilding landscapes across Europe, showcasing rewilding in action, building momentum and helping to reconnect people with wild nature with great success.

Since the 20th business anniversary in 2021, one of the goals of ES has been to have more of a positive impact through its own operations and the work done with clients. As part of a positive impact campaign in 2022, ES made donations supporting the European Young Rewilders and the comeback of wild horses. This led to further discussions about the importance of biodiversity and rewilding landscapes and the most beneficial ways to provide more long-term impactful support.

As part of the new agreement, ES will provide a percentage of its annual turnover over the next decade, with the money initially used to support Rewilding Europe’s recently launched European Wildlife Comeback Fund, which is working to scale up keystone species reintroduction and population reinforcement across Europe.
ES will also provide pro bono advice on rewilding-related buildings – such as new offices and rewilding centers – to Rewilding Europe and Rewilding Europe network organisations. “We look forward to bringing our experience and knowledge of sustainable building to the projects of our partner Rewilding Europe to create healthy and sustainable spaces for the people who work and visit there,” Ingemar Hunold emphasized.
